Benign Prostatic Hyperplasia

Ben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H)—called prostate gland enlargement—is a common condition as men get older. An enlarged prostate gland can cause uncomfortable urinary symptoms, such as blocking the flow of urine out of the bladder.

Erectile Dysfunction (ED)

Erectile dysfunction (impotence) is the inability to get and keep an erection firm enough for sex. Sometimes, treating an underlying condition is enough to reverse erectile dysfunction. In other cases, medications or other direct treatments might be needed.

Male Infertility

Male fertility factors are involved in half of all couples struggling to achieve a pregnancy. Male infertility can also be a sign of other medical problems. Treatment approaches may involve lifestyle change, medications, or sometimes procedural solutions.

Male Stress Incontinence

Male stress incontinence often occurs after prostate surgery. It is the loss of urine when you are active such as walking, lifting and coughing. Treatment approaches may involve behavior and lifestyle change or sometimes procedural solutions.

Male Urethral Stricture

Male urethral stricture disease is a non-cancerous narrowing of the urethra sometimes the result of trauma. This results in problems with urinating including pain, difficulty starting and weakened stream, retention of urine, infection and sometimes bleeding.

Peyronie's Disease

Peyronie's (pay-roe-NEEZ) disease is a noncancerous condition resulting from fibrous scar tissue that develops on the penis and causes curved, painful erections. Peyronie's disease may cause significant bend or pain in some men.

Vasectomy

Vasectomy is a clinic procedure with a low risk of complications or side effects. Other than abstinence, vasectomy has the highest success rate (nearly 100 percent) in preventing pregnancy by cutting the tubes that transport sperm.

Vasectomy Reversal

Vasectomy reversal is surgery to undo a vasectomy. It involves re-connecting the previously cut tubes (vas deferens). It successful, sperm are again present in the semen, and you may be able to get your partner pregnant.
